What is a Gemba Expert and why it is essential for Lean organizations
Gemba (現場) experts are people who specialize in working on and with the gemba. What exactly is Gemba? It's a Japanese term that literally means "the actual place," or: the place where the work actually happens (the shop floor, operations, practice).
In Lean, gemba revolves around the principle: go and see where the work happens instead of just relying on reports or assumptions.
What does a Gemba expert do?
A Gemba expert helps organizations better understand processes by:
- observing on the shop floor themselves;
- speaking with employees who perform the work;
- directly identifying bottlenecks, waste, and improvement opportunities;
- guiding teams in improving their processes.
What are their strengths?
Gemba experts often combine:
- Lean knowledge (such as recognizing muda, mura, muri);
- observation and analytical skills;
- coaching and communication;
- the ability to distinguish facts from assumptions.
